Rasuwa Flood Victims to Get Up to 50% Advance Insurance Payments

September 5th, 2026

Kathmandu — The government has decided to provide advance insurance claim payments to policyholders affected by the Rasuwa floods based on preliminary damage assessments. The provision was introduced through the ‘Rasuwa Flood Recovery Package’ unveiled by the Ministry of Finance on Thursday.

According to the ministry, surveyors will be deployed through a simplified procedure to make the assessment of flood-related insurance claims faster and more effective.

Under the new arrangement, insurers will provide advance claim payments of up to 50 percent to policyholders filing claims for flood-related losses, based on preliminary assessment reports.

The ministry said reinsurers will also provide advance claim payments of up to 50 percent to insurers.

To make the claim settlement process simpler, more convenient and effective for flood-affected policyholders, insurers will be required to promptly formulate and implement simplified claim settlement procedures.

The government expects the measure to enable policyholders affected by the Rasuwa floods to receive financial relief based on preliminary damage assessments before the full claim assessment and settlement process is completed.
